A pallet is Available at a location. Dispatch makes it In-Transit — recording where it is going and which note sent it. Receive books it into the destination and links back to the dispatch note it arrived against. The link is captured at scan time, which is why reconciliation is arithmetic, not archaeology.

Tag physics decides read reliability more than any software setting. Wood and plastic take a standard pallet tag; steel needs an on-metal tag that uses the surface as part of its antenna. Reads come from a handheld sweep, a dock-door gate, or a Bluetooth reader paired to any Android phone.

View Product →Each pallet carries a UHF RFID tag with a unique ID. At dispatch, an operator sweeps the load with a handheld reader or drives it through a gate — every movement writes an immutable dispatch or receive note (GRN). Reconciliation then compares the two sides per note: dispatched minus received equals what is still on the road.
Wooden and plastic pallets take the UMT pallet tag built on the Impinj M830 chip — screwed or riveted to the stringer. Steel pallets, cages and roll containers need an on-metal tag such as the Encore, which uses the metal surface as part of its antenna instead of being detuned by it.
Yes. The handheld stores every movement in an offline outbox with a unique transaction ID and replays it when connectivity returns. The server recognises replayed transactions and returns the original note instead of creating a duplicate, so a retry can never double-count stock.
A UHF sweep reads every tag in range without line of sight — a full truckload of 100+ tagged pallets is typically captured in a single walk-around sweep of a few seconds, compared with scanning barcodes one pallet at a time.
A UHF sweep in a busy yard reads whatever is in range, including a neighbour's pallets. The system resolves every tag against the pallet register and, by default, only registered pallets enter the note — unresolved tags stay visible but marked as not being saved, so nothing is counted silently.
A typical site runs CX1500N handheld readers for bulk dispatch and receive sweeps, UHF gate readers on high-volume dock doors for hands-free capture, and the MUBR01 Bluetooth reader paired to a phone at light-volume client sites.
